Function âand âŁRole of⤠the⢠Dual Gas Safety valve⢠in Frigidaire Oven Ranges
The⣠3203459 Frigidaire Oven Range Dual Gas Safety Valve is a âtwo-seat, electrically actuated safety component that sits between the incoming gas supply and the oven burner assembly. Its primary âfunction is to provide â˘redundant⣠mechanical shutoff:â both â¤valve seats remain closed⢠until theâ oven’s ignition and control system confirm aâ safe â¤conditionand the solenoid(s) receive theâ proper control⢠signal to energize. Inâ normal operation the valve will remain closedâ during âŁignition â˘sequencing and⤠will open only when the control board commands it; âon flame failure or loss ofâ control signal the valve returnsâ to the⤠closed⤠positionâ to blockâ gas flow. â¤The internal design combines a⢠gas passage,two âdiscrete sealing elements for redundancy,and a solenoid actuation mechanism so that a single faultâ inâ one seat or coil âŁisâ less likely to produce an uncontrolledâ release of fuel.
Technicians should treat this valve as anâ interdependent part⢠of the range’s ignition and safety circuits and confirm mechanical and electrical â˘compatibility before replacement. Typical field checks include verifying coil continuityâ with an ohmmeter, â¤checking that the control board supplies the expected âactuation voltage at the valve connector during a call for heatand observing a distinct mechanical⤠âclickâ when the valve operatesâ while⢠monitoring for â¤proper gas⢠flow only⢠when energized. After installation always perform â˘a pressure or leak test at the fittings and validate that the oven cycles safely through ignition. Common service indicators of valve⤠degradation âinclude a burner that âŁnever receives gas despite âcorrect ignition sequencing, intermittent âoperation correlated âwith connector⣠or coil faultsor⣠persistentâ ignition failure despite correct voltage from the⣠control⤠module.
- Primary â˘functions: redundant âŁshutoff,â prevents gas âŁflow onâ flame failure.
- Diagnostic checks: coil resistance, âactuation voltage, audible operation,⤠leak/pressure âtest.
- Compatibility â¤checks: confirm mounting, inlet/outlet fittings and âelectrical connector match the range model before replacement.

How the 3203459 Frigidaire Oven Range Dualâ Gas Safety valve Operates within the â˘Gas Delivery and electronic âControl System
The 3203459 Frigidaire Oven â¤Range Dual Gas Safety Valve â is an âŁelectromechanical safety device thatâ controlsâ gas flow toâ separate âbake and broil⣠circuits in compatible Frigidaire ranges. âŁInternally it contains two spring-loadedâ valve â¤seats and corresponding solenoid âactuators; each solenoid remains closedâ until⤠the oven’s electronic âcontrol and ignition circuit call âfor⢠heat.In practice, the control boardâ sequencesâ the igniterâ and the valve: the igniterâ must draw sufficient current or reach a target temperature, theâ control then applies voltage to the appropriate solenoidand the valve permits gasâ to the burner. Proper function therefore dependsâ on correct â˘electrical signals from the control â˘board, â˘aâ functioning igniterand compatible connector/mounting geometry for the specific âmodel range.
Technically, the valve operates âas a safety âinterlock ratherâ than a modulating device: it provides â˘on/off control and relies on the âigniter and control electronics to manage timing and flame â˘establishment. Technicians verify behavior by checking coil continuity, âconfirming presenceâ of control voltage at the⣠valve⤠terminals during a heat call, â¤and âobserving the ignition⤠sequence;⤠a healthy valve will remain⣠closed with no applied voltage and⤠open promptly when the â¤board signals after the igniter preheat.For replacement âŁor troubleshooting, â¤match âŁterminal type,â bracket⢠spacingand electricalâ interface⢠to the oven model; common practical checks include measuring coil âresistance, âobserving âwhether the valve clicks âandâ supplies â¤gas only when the igniter is hotand â¤isolating whether failuresâ are electrical (control/igniter) â¤or mechanical (stuck⤠valve).
- Features: dual solenoid safety operation for autonomous bake âŁand broil control
- Behavior: âremains closed⣠until control and igniter conditions are met; â¤provides âbinaryâ on/off gas flow
- Troubleshooting steps: continuity â¤test,â verify control voltage during a heat call, inspect connector and âmounting
- Compatibility â¤note: must match ârange-specificâ connector, mounting⢠pattern, âand⣠electricalâ characteristics

Common âFailure Symptoms, Diagnostic Tests and⤠Troubleshooting Procedures for dual Gas âSafety Valve Faults
The⢠3203459 Frigidaire Oven Range Dual Gas Safety Valve is a⣠combined pilot and main-gas shutoff component that holds manifold pressure until an⢠electricalâ control or flame-sensingâ element âŁpermits flow. In normal âoperation âthe valve â˘remains closed against a spring-loaded seat; when the control applies the correct actuation voltage⣠the internal solenoid(s) lift⣠the seat to allow â˘gas â˘to⢠the pilot âŁand main burners. failures present as either âŁa valve âthat will not open underâ command (no gasâ to burners despite correct âŁcontrol signals) or a â˘valve⣠that leaks gas whenâ de-energized. âCompatibility requires matching⤠the valve porting, mountingand control-voltage⢠characteristics to the range model;â replacing a valve withâ the â¤wrong coil âvoltage orâ port layout can âproduce â¤intermittent operation âor âunsafe leakage.â Practical âfield âobservation commonly links valve faults with other â˘subsystemâ failures (weak igniter, failed flameâ sensor, âdamaged âwiring), so isolate and âverify the âcontrol circuit before condemning âthe valve itself.
Diagnostic work⢠begins âwithâ safety: shut off âgas âandâ power âŁbefore disconnecting lines or⣠performing continuity checks. Inspect âwiring⢠and connectors, then⢠use a multimeter to verify coil continuityâ and absence⢠of shorts⤠to⤠chassis; an open⣠coil⤠or a⢠short to ground indicates the valve should be replaced. A âcontrolled bench or â¤in-situ actuation test⣠with the correct rated voltage verifies âmechanical movement and proper sealing – if⤠the valve âenergizes âbut the downstream pressure does not change, measure âmanifold pressureâ with a manometer âand perform a soap-bubble leak test â˘at seals⤠and fittings. Troubleshooting steps: confirm the igniter/thermocouple/flame-sensing circuit is delivering the correct command, âverify valve coil electrical characteristics against the service specification,⤠and replace theâ valve âŁif it⢠leaks under no-voltage conditions or fails toâ respond predictably to âaâ proper control âsignal. Keep records of measured resistance, applied voltageand pressure âreadings to compare with manufacturer service limits before âfinal⣠replacement.
- No gas âflow to âburners despite â¤correct control âsignal
- Uncommanded gas flow â¤or â˘smell of gasâ when appliance is âoff
- intermittent burner lighting or delayed ignition
- Visible corrosion, damaged electrical connector,â or oil/grease contamination on the valveâ body

Compatibility, Model Fitment,⢠Replacement⤠Considerations and Installation Procedures for Part 3203459
The⣠3203459 Frigidaire⢠Ovenâ Rangeâ Dual âGas Safety Valve is aâ two-circuit, â˘solenoid-actuated isolation valve âthat âcontrols gas supply to separate oven burners (typically bake and broil) and âprovides positive shut-off âon âloss of control signal or â¤pilot.â It functions âas a normally-closed safety device: control circuitry or an igniter⣠module energizes the appropriate solenoid to allow gas flow â¤onlyâ during a confirmed ignition sequence.â Compatibility â˘depends âon manifold⤠port spacing,â inlet/outlet orientation, electrical connector âtype andâ pressureâ rating; verify theâ OEM part number or cross-reference and confirm the⤠harness connector⤠and mounting bracket alignment before âsubstitution. For â˘example, replacing this valve on a 30-inch Frigidaire range typically requires matching the manifoldâ screw patternâ and confirming whether the appliance uses naturalâ gas or⤠has been converted to LP,⣠since conversion requires the correct orifice and pressure regulation âŁcomponents â˘in addition âto the valve.
- Fitment⤠checks: OEM part â˘numberâ match,connector style,manifold port⣠spacing,andâ gas⤠type (natural/LP).
- Pre-replacement diagnostics: measureâ solenoid⤠continuity, âobserve ignition behaviorand check âfor delayed⢠or absent gas flow.
- safety steps âto â¤prepare: shut âŁoff gas and electrical supply,depressurize⤠the line,and⢠document⤠valveâ orientation and gasket locations.
replacement procedure and functional verification require⣠methodical mechanical andâ leak-safety steps: isolate gas and electric power, remove⤠the burner access panel, âdisconnect the electrical harness and thermocouple or⢠flame-sensing leads, note and preserve mountingâ hardware and gaskets, swap the âvalve maintaining theâ original orientation, then reassemble using newâ gaskets or âŁseals. After âinstallation, â¤perform a controlled pressurization⢠andâ leak test with a â˘soap âsolution âor⣠electronic detectorâ at âall âjoints â¤and the âŁvalve body, â˘then run â¤controlled⢠ignition cycles to confirm that eachâ solenoid⢠opens only when itsâ control circuit is energized andâ that flame supervision devices terminate gas on loss â˘of âflame. If⣠diagnostics show â˘coil âopen-circuit, â˘persistent unregulated gas âflowor failed⣠leak tests, doâ not return the âappliance to service until the fault isâ corrected âorâ the replacement valve is validatedâ by a â˘qualified technician.

Q&A
What is â¤the 3203459 Frigidaire âŁOvenâ Range Dual Gas Safety Valveâ andâ what does it do?
Theâ 3203459⣠is the oven gasâ safety valve â¤assembly used on⤠certain Frigidaire ranges.⤠“Dual”⤠means it contains two⤠internal â˘shutoff ports/solenoids – typically one for⣠the bake burner âŁand one for⤠the broil âburner. The⤠valve is a⤠normally-closed safetyâ device⤠thatâ onlyâ allows⢠gas to flow to the burners⤠when the oven⣠control/igniter requestsâ heat⤠and the valve isâ energized âorâ the ignition â˘circuit conditions are met.
What âare âcommon symptoms thatâ this dual gas safety valve is failing?
Typical signs include: âŁthe oven will not heat⣠at âall (no gasâ flow), only one function worksâ (bake or broil but not both),⢠intermittent âheating, audible humming or â˘clicking âfrom the valve, a persistent⢠gas smell near âŁthe oven (possible stuck-open condition)orâ failure to light whileâ the igniter glows. These symptoms can also be â˘causedâ byâ igniters, control boards, wiring or gas âsupply issues,⣠so proper diagnosis isâ required.
How can⤠a âtechnician testâ the valve âto confirm it isâ indeed bad?
Standard safe âdiagnostic â¤steps: 1) Disconnectâ power and gas before servicing. âŁ2) Visually inspect â¤the valve and wiring for damage or⢠corrosion. 3) With the control calling for âheat, measure the voltage at â¤the valve connector to confirm â¤the âcontrolâ is âŁsending the âproper signal (refer to the âservice manual⤠for expected voltage). 4) With power removed, check coil continuity/resistance with â¤a â¤multimeter and compare to the â˘specification in âthe⢠service âŁdata;â an open coil indicates failure.5) If the coils âhave âcorrect⢠resistance but the valve does not pass gas when âcorrectly energized, the valve is mechanically defective. â˘Do⤠not apply mains power directly to the valve as a bench testâ unless you are trained and⣠have proper safety precautions⣠in place.
Can â¤I âŁreplace the 3203459 valve myselfandâ whatâ are the â¤basic steps?
Replacing the valve âis absolutely possible for⣠a competent diyer with appliance experience, but as it involves gas and live electrical connections âŁit is indeed recommended that a licensed technician perform the⣠work. Basic replacement steps: shut off the gas supply and disconnect electrical âpower; âremove the back or lowerâ access⣠panel to reach âthe â˘valve; disconnect electrical connectors and â˘gas âŁlineâ (use appropriate wrenches, noteâ orientation); install â¤the ânew âvalve in the same orientation âusing a new âgasket orâ seal ifâ supplied; tighten fittings âto proper torque;â restore âŁgas and performâ a soap-solution or electronic leak âcheck on all joints;â restoreâ power⣠and test⣠bake⢠and â˘broil operations.⣠Never test for leaks with an open flame.
How do I make sure I âget the correct replacement â¤partâ for my range?
Always verify compatibility â˘by the oven/range model ânumber (the tag âusually âfound â˘behind the drawer, on the oven frameor on the âback). Useâ that model number when ordering âparts or consult âŁFrigidaire’s parts lookup or âan authorized parts distributor. Visually compare the replacement to the⢠original â(mounting âŁholes, gas ports, electrical connector⤠type and number âŁof ports).⣠if you intend to convert from⣠natural gas to LP,⤠check whether the valve requires a conversion⤠kit orâ specificâ orifice âchanges âas noted in âthe service manual.
Does the valve⤠need âadjustment â¤or calibration after installation?
Mostâ oven gas âŁsafety valves do not require calibration. After installation you should: confirm proper orientation andâ secureâ mounting, checkâ forâ leaks atâ all gas joints, restore powerand verify correct operation of both bake and broil functionsâ across temperature â¤ranges. If you performed âŁan LP/NG conversion, follow the manufacturer’s instructions⣠for orifice/regulator âchanges and âany â˘required adjustments. â˘If âthe ovenâ control⤠has âa self-test or diagnostic âmode, run it per the service manual.
What safety precautions should I â¤follow⤠around a suspected valve failure or gas leak?
If you⤠smell gas âor suspect aâ valve is leaking: do⢠not operate electricalâ switches,doâ not⣠useâ open flames,ventilate the â˘area by⣠opening âŁwindows and doors,shut off the gas âsupply at the⣠appliance⣠or house main if⢠you⣠can do so safely,and evacuate âif the smell is strong. call your âŁgas utility⣠or a licensed â¤appliance technician⢠immediately. Becauseâ a stuck-open valve is âŁa serious hazard, do notâ attemptâ to use the oven until a⣠qualified personâ has verified and⣠repaired âthe problem.
How âis a “dual” valve different from a single valve and does that affect repairs?
A dual valve contains â¤two separate â˘internal shutoff passages â(one forâ bake, oneâ forâ broil) controlled by⢠separate solenoids; a single valve has only one outlet. Repairâ considerations: âwith a dual valve⤠a single-coil⣠failure⢠can disable one âŁfunction while the other still âworks, which⤠helps â˘diagnose the problem.⤠When replacing, be sure to match theâ number of ports â¤and⤠mounting arrangement -⢠substituting⢠a single-port valve where â˘aâ dual is⣠requiredâ will not ârestore full⤠oven functionality.
